how to enter accent ring u

I've tried various ways I found on the web but couldn't get the letter "u" with a ring (˚) on top. I have tried Option+"u" but that just gives me two dots on top. I've also tried Option+K,"u" but that gives me the ring with the letter "u" to the right of it.


Can someone please help? Thanks.

Top menu > Keyboard Layout > Show Character Viewer >Latin and scroll down to the alternate 'u' characters and double click it to paste.
